In promotion of their upcomingKinectimalsrelease Microsoft will be partnering with theBuild-A-Bear Workshopin offering up four collectible teddies. In what can only be called the sneakiest DLC ever, these $18 plushies can be scanned into the 360 via Kinect to unlock their in-game counterparts. I can only imagine how many of these will sell to whiny children at malls across America as Microsoft laughs all the way to the bank.

Now With Bearswill be available for $49.99 come October 11th. Alternatively,Kinectimalsowners can pick up the “Bear Island” add-on for a cool $14.99. Either way the game includes two new quests and five bear cubs to hang out with. And if you couldn’t already tell, I just can’t get enough of that baby Panda. It’s just so cute.
